Structured mental health initiatives
Supporting positive mental health in schools begins with structured, practical planning.
Our Mental Health Action Planner has been developed to help teachers and schools design inclusive school wellbeing initiatives and activities.
The tool can help raise awareness of mental health, reduce mental health stigma in schools and foster healthy habits among students.
Our resource will guide teachers and school staff through every stage of planning; from setting goals and identifying the main audience to organising activities, and evaluating impact.
The resource is available in both English and Irish languages for use in schools across Ireland.
Using the planner
By using our new resource, teachers and school staff can:
- Plan impactful events: Map out mental health days, workshops or campaigns. Integrate mental health promotion into school policies and repeat successful events
- Engage students: Involve student councils or wellbeing groups in promoting activities
- Collaborate with colleagues: Share responsibilities and plan across departments
- Track progress: Monitor what’s planned, in progress or completed
- Promote inclusivity: Design initiatives for students, parents, staff or the whole school community
- Evaluate impact: Use surveys and feedback to improve future activities.
